Handover Note — Director Transition

From the outgoing to the incoming Director of Procurement, copied to heads of department. The priority item is the Ostrell Fabrication contract, expiring at the end of Q2. Pricing has held steady for three years, but their new account lead has signaled a proposed increase tied to raw-material indexing. I recommend opening renewal talks early and benchmarking against Vandermoor Supply before committing. The sensitivity here is best explained by the confidential note that follows.

confidential, hahop-bajep: Gross margin on Ralath came in at 5 percent against a plan of 10 percent. Only 9 of the 100 pilot accounts renewed Ralath, so a churn review is set for April 1.

Nice work on the retry wrapper — one thing before I approve. Plugin authors building on the Tollgate SDK need the idempotency key to stay stable across retries, and your current code regenerates it whenever the payload is re-serialized. That means a flaky network can turn one charge into three. Derive the key from the payment intent once, cache it, and let it expire on our schedule, not yours. The limits your plugin must respect are these.

limits module of bawef-bajep:
CAPS = {
    "novvan": 877,
    "quenvan": 327,
}

Minutes — Management Meeting

Prepared for the incoming director. Topic: possible acquisition of Greyfen Analytics. Due diligence 70% complete. Valuation gap remains; Greyfen seeks a premium. Integration risks flagged by Ops. Decision deferred to next month. Talla Nyberg leads negotiations. Our walk-away position is stated below.

board note of fawig-kagup: Only 48 of the 435 pilot accounts renewed Rusion, so a churn review is set for September 12. Fenwynox Logistics is in early talks to buy Sorielek Systems for about $117.8 million.

Quick handover before Thursday's sync: I finished vendoring the Bramblewood type family into the Quillfort repo, so we no longer pull fonts from the old CDN at build time. Licenses are checked into the assets folder, and the subsetting script runs in CI. One loose end: the font vault in our secrets manager needs re-auth every 90 days. If it locks you out before I'm back, the recovery passphrase is below.

unlock words, yawig-kagef: gordor-holvan-ulaael-pramir-ulaiel-tamdor